ROMSTAL European Under-13 Championships: Favorites Dominate Mixed Teams Event

The ROMSTAL European Under-13 Championships commenced today with strong performances from the favorites in the Mixed Teams Event.

Group A: Germany featuring Tien Nghia HONG Anna WALTER Amelie Guzi JIA and Lukas WALTER triumphed over both Serbia and Sweden.

Group B: The host nation represented by David TORO Maya MADAR Kariss SERBAN and Alexandru POP dominated the competition defeating both Ukraine and Montenegro.

Group C: Croatia caused an upset with Mateo TERIHAJ Sara RIVETTI Karla IVCIC and Nikola JURIC overcoming the third seed Hungary. However Hungary managed to secure a victory against Portugal.

Group D: Last year’s winners Türkiye showed their strength by overcoming Switzerland and Belgium. The Turkish team includes Gorkem OCAL Ela Su YÖNTER Ayten Ceren KAHRAMAN and Kuzey GUNDOGDU.

Group E: The top seed in this group Czechia beat Greece but fell to Poland. Poland’s team consisting of Adam STACHOWIAK Lena PUZIO Lucja KOBOSZ and Hubert KWIECINSKI also prevailed against Moldova.

Group F: France leads the group with two wins over Spain and Italy. The French team includes Noah TESSIER Lisa ZHAO Eva LAM and Nolan JOHNSTON.

Group G: Austria’s team composed of Louis FEGERL Sophia PICHLER Jasmin CHEN and Seung Jin CHEN upset the rankings by defeating the top seed in their group Azerbaijan. Austria also beat Estonia while Azerbaijan overcame England.

Group H: Slovakia the leader of the group lost both matches against Bulgaria and Israel. Bulgaria’s team featuring Miroslav SCHMIDT Polina ENCHEVA Beloslava BALKANSKA and Viktor DIMITROV also triumphed over Lithuania. Israel’s team including Nir ENGLER Gali BEZALEL Ofek NAHUSHI and Maor NICHANEVICH secured wins against Slovakia and Lithuania.

The competition continues with teams battling for top positions in their respective groups.

The European Table Tennis Union (ETTU) is the governing body of the sport of table tennis in Europe, and is the only authority recognized for this purpose by the International Table Tennis Federation. The ETTU deals with all matters relating to table tennis at a European level, including the development and promotion of the sport in the territories controlled by its 58 member associations, and the organization of continental table tennis competitions, including the European Championships.
